Resorts World Sentosa opens two new hotels

On 16 February 2012, Resorts World® Sentosa (RWS) will open the doors to not one but two eco-luxurious hotels - the Equarius Hotel and Beach Villas - at its 49-hectare mega-resort. The two hotels are set to redefine resort-style vacations in Singapore with 360-degree views that take in the waterfront, the harbourfront skyline and a lush tropical rainforest.

Paul Rushton has been appointed as Regional Director of MICE Sales Asia Pacific at Marriott International

Marriott International has appointed Paul Rushton as regional director of MICE Sales Asia Pacific. In his new role, Rushton will be responsible for the design and implementation of sales and marketing strategies and growing market share of MICE business for all Marriott branded hotels in Asia Pacific. He is based in Singapore. Rushton was previously director at Marriott International. He has also held management position with the Peninsula Group.

Manfred Weber has been appointed as General Manager at Shangri-La Hotel, Singapore

Manfred Weber has been appointed as the new general manager of Shangri-La Hotel, Singapore with effect from 19 December 2011. In his new role, Weber is responsible for the success of the hotel’s daily operations and special projects, such as the renovation of the Garden Wing and launch of Singapore’s first CHI, The Spa. Prior to joining Shangri-La Hotel, Singapore, Weber spent 11 years in Shanghai and Beijing with luxury hotel companies, including the Ritz Carlton and Peninsula. “As our group expands, new talents are needed to replace general managers who are now promoted to senior levels. Mr. Weber is a natural choice for Shangri-La Hotel, Singapore since he is proficient in managing similar world-class hotels and discerning clientele with proven track record. I am confident that Mr. Weber will continue to uphold our legacy of Shangri-La hospitality from a caring family,” said Michael Cottan, executive vice president of South-East Asia and the Pacific, Shangri-la.

Intelligent Spas' New Singapore Spa Report Finds Unprecedented Changes

Intelligent Spas' new Singapore Spa Benchmark Report identified the spa industry underwent significant changes between 2009 and 2010. "Unprecedented changes have occurred in the Singapore spa market which are the most dramatic seen by Intelligent Spas within any spa industry it has studied over the last 10 years", explained Julie Garrow, Managing Director of 100% independent research company Intelligent Spas (www.IntelligentSpas.com).

John Pang has been appointed as Executive Assistant Manager at Concorde Hotel Singapore

With over 16 years of experience in the industry, John started his career with the HPL Group as Assistant Outlet Manager at the former Concorde Hotel located at Havelock Road in August 1995. He later held the position of Assistant F&B Manager at the same Hotel before moving to Hard Rock Hotel Pattaya in April 2005 as Assistant Director of F&B. John was subsequently promoted to Director of F&B at Hard Rock Hotel Pattaya.

Olivier Horps has been named Chief Executive Officer of the Greater China Business Unit at Club Med

Olivier Horps has been appointed Chief Executive Officer of the new Greater China Business Unit. Olivier joined Club Med in 2007 and has demonstrated his capacity to develop growth in Asia. He was successively appointed Sales and Marketing Director, Asia, and Managing Director, Asia-Pacific. He will relocate to Shanghai to lead Club Med’s development of the Greater China Business Unit.

Heidi Kunkel has been named CEO East & South Asia & Pacific at Club Med

Heidi Kunkel has been promoted to Chief Executive Officer, East & South Asia & Pacific, and will now be based in Singapore. Heidi joined Club Med in 2003, and was most recently President of Japan and Korea and previously held the position of General Manager Pacific. She has promoted strong growth in the Asia Pacific region and also improved business performance in Japan despite a difficult context. Heidi will now develop and grow Club Med’s business further in the East & South Asia & Pacific markets.
